Beyond the Tomb: Exploring the "Poon Raider" Phenomenon in Popular Media
The intersection of mainstream entertainment and adult parodies has long been a curious space in pop culture. One of the most notable examples from recent years is Poon Raider: A DP XXX Parody (2018)
. Produced by Digital Playground, this adult film isn't just another entry in a niche genre—it represents a specific era of "parody entertainment" that mirrors major Hollywood releases with surprising timing and stylistic mimicry. The Context: A Strategic Release
Released in March 2018, the parody was strategically timed to coincide with the theatrical debut of the Tomb Raider reboot starring Alicia Vikander. This "mockbuster" strategy is common in the adult industry, where studios leverage the massive marketing budgets of Hollywood blockbusters to gain visibility for their own comedic or adult-themed interpretations. Poon Raider: A DP XXX Parody is a 2018 adult entertainment film produced by Digital Playground. It is an adult parody of the popular Tomb Raider media franchise. Content and Synopsis
The story follows Laura Crotch (a parody of Lara Croft), who returns to her family estate, Crotch Manor, following the death of her father.
Plot: Laura discovers her father's estate and "Crotch Industries" are being controlled by an unknown stepmother, Mrs. Crotch. The Power of Parody in Entertainment The Poon
Quest: She embarks on a hunt to retrieve a rare family artifact while navigating double-crosses from her sidekick, Rina, and her stepmother's assistant.
Structure: The film features four major vignettes that blend low-budget action and fight scenes with adult content. Production Details
Release Date: March 14, 2018 (timed near the release of the 2018 Tomb Raider theatrical film).
Director: Danny D (with Dick Bush credited for significant direction and cinematography). Lead Cast: Kimmy Granger as Laura Crotch. Rina Ellis as Rina. Tina Kay as Mrs. Crotch. Media Influence and Reception
